Excel2019如何多列篩選統計

2022-06-10 11:36:27 字數 6861 閱讀 6163

1樓:匿名使用者

高階篩選

在工作表中對「本息」和「存期」進行高階篩選。篩選條件為:「本息》=20030」並且「存期<3」,或者「存期=5」,條件區域存放在a16開始的單元格區域,篩選結果存放在a20開始的單元格區域。

操作方法如下:

①將sheet4工作表重新命名為「高階篩選」。

②填寫篩選條件。將欄位名「本息」、「存期」複製到a16開始的單元格,在a17單元格中輸入「本息》=20030」,在b17單元格中輸入「存期<3」(參見圖4.2.9所示)。

③將插入點定位在資料清單任一位置,單擊「資料」|「篩選」|「高階篩選」命令,開啟「高階篩選」對話方塊。

圖4.2.8    「高階篩選」對話方塊

④設定「資料區域」、「條件區域」和結果「複製到」的內容。

設定「資料區域」時,可以直接輸入區域$a$2:$h$14,或通過「摺疊」按鈕 在資料清單中選擇資料區域。用同樣的方法設定「條件區域」和結果「複製到」的位置,如圖4.

2.8所示。

⑤單擊「確定」按鈕執行高階篩選操作,其篩選結果如圖4.2.9所示。

圖4.2.9    高階篩選示例

2樓:山桑弓

假設ab列的資料在a2:b20中,計算月份為9月,地址為廣州的客戶個數,c2中輸入

=sumproduct((month(a2:a20)=9)*(b2:b20="廣州"))

或者廣州"))都可以

3樓:萊昂納德_尤拉

假如你的資料在1到100行

=sumprodcut(--(month(a1:a100)=9),--(b1:b100)="廣州")

4樓:匿名使用者

=sum(if(month(a2:a100)=9,if(b2:b100="廣州",1,0)))

注意:ctrl+shift+enter

5樓:

=sumproduct(--((b1:b100)="廣州"),--(month(a1:a100)=9))

試試這個 !包你滿意!

excel如何同時篩選多列資料?

6樓:汽車影老師

1、第一步:開啟一個需要同時篩選兩列資料的excel**。

2、第二步:在**的空白區域中輸入要篩選的條件(1班,英語大於90分)。

3、第三步:選擇「資料」選單中的「高階篩選」。

4、第四步:在彈出的「高階篩選」對話方塊中,滑鼠左鍵單擊列表區域欄位後面的按鈕。

5、第五步:拖動滑鼠選中全部資料,單擊紅色圓圈標記的按鈕返回「高階篩選」對話方塊。

6、第六步:滑鼠左鍵單擊條件區域欄位後面的按鈕。

7、第七步:選中我們設定的篩選條件,單擊紅色圓圈中的按鈕返回。

8、第八步:在「高階篩選」對話方塊中,單擊「確定」按鈕。

9、需要的資料就被篩選出來了。

7樓:迷你手工老張

可以根據以下步驟操作。

1、開啟需要處理的文件。

2、選中需要處理的單元格。

3、點選【排序和篩選】。

4、在出來的選單中點選【篩選】。

5、點選體重右邊的小三角出來的選單中點選【數字篩選】。

6、點選【大於】。

7、輸入數值點選確定。

8、點選之後大於70體重的結果就篩選出來了。

9、同樣的方法選擇身高篩選出身高180以上的。

10、同時滿足這兩項的結果就篩選出來了。

8樓:在朱家尖休息的露珠

你好,很高興為你解答

其實對於這個你可以做一個輔助列,統計a:f有多少個√我根據你的**做了一個例子,如圖

在k列做了一個輔助列,在k2單元格輸入公式=countif(c2:h2,「√」)

然後向下填充,最後對k列進行篩選大於0的

效果如圖

望採納,謝謝!

9樓:未來還在那裡嗎

「1、點選開啟我們的excel**。2、選中需要處理的單元格。3、點選上面的「排序和篩選」。

4、點選選擇「篩選」。5、點選想要篩選的列表的列名後面的三角形,點選上面的「數字篩選」。6、選擇你想使用的關係名稱,例如「大於」。

7、例如輸入...」

10樓:

g列建立輔助列

g2輸入

=if(countif(a2:f2,"√")=6,"k","")下拉公式

然後篩選,g列含有 k 的即可

11樓:

如果多列同時符合條件,只要用自動篩選就可以。

如果多列的條件是or(或)的關係,就要用高階篩選 。

在空白的單元格輸入條件,如果是or(或)的關係,每個條件一行。

12樓:青戮

同是選中a到f行 再進行篩選就好了 只有有符合條件的 都會顯示出來的

如何在excel同時多列進行分類彙總和計數?

13樓:夜半凍檸樂

1. 首先對資料按需要分類彙總的列(本例為「城市」列)進行排序。

選擇「城市」列中的任意單元格,在excel 2003中單擊工具欄中的排序按鈕如「a→z」。在excel 2007中,選擇功能區中「資料」選項卡,在「排序和篩選」組中單擊「a→z」按鈕。

2. 選擇資料區域中的某個單元格,在excel 2003中單擊選單「資料→分類彙總」。如果是excel 2007,則在「資料」選項卡的「分級顯示」組中單擊「分類彙總」。

3. 在彈出的「分類彙總」對話方塊中,在「分類欄位」下選擇「城市」,在「彙總方式」中選擇某種彙總方式,可供選擇的彙總方式有「求和」、「計數」、「平均值」等,本例中選擇預設的「求和」。在「選定彙總項」下僅選擇「銷售額」。

4.單擊確定,excel將按城市進行分類彙總。

excel中如何對多列進行篩選?多列滿足只要一個條件即可·(**等答案)

14樓:匿名使用者

假設資料從a列到m列,則可在最後一列旁邊的空白列(第n列)中的n3中寫入公式:

=if(sumif(b$2:m$2,"返修",b3:m3),"有返修記錄","")

下拉複製公式。

最後篩選該列中公式結果為「有返修記錄」的行即可。

可根據實際資料區域修改公式中的引數。

15樓:

篩選條件是什麼不是很明白,若要讓其滿足任一條件,把條件放在不同行(在高階篩選中是這樣的)。

16樓:我崽叫忠誠

像這種情況,必須是要加一個統計列,然後直接篩選統計列,,解決方案如圖 (條件列為統計總返修次數,可通過篩選其大於0來得到你要的結果,本公式一經設定,再往後面加日期,都不需要修改公式。)

在一張excel表中,我想統計兩列資料,並進行篩選,如何操作?

17樓:安全管理人

使用 countif 或者sumif進行統計篩選

sumif 函式得出數字集合的和,且僅包括滿足指定條件的數字。

sumif(待檢驗的值, 條件, 待求和的值)

待檢驗的值: 集合,包含要測試的值。 待檢驗的值可以包含任何值。

條件: 比較或檢驗值,並返回布林值 true 或 false 的表示式。 條件可包括比較運算子、常數、與符號並置運算子、引用表示式和萬用字元。

您可以使用萬用字元來匹配表示式中的任何單個字元或多個字元。您可以使用的萬用字元包括 ?(問號)、*(星號)以及 ~(波浪號)。

若要查詢有關萬用字元的更多資訊,請開啟應用程式中的「幫助」選單,然後在搜尋欄輸入「萬用字元」。

待求和的值: 可選集合,含有要進行求和的值。 待求和的值可以包含數字值、日期/時間值或持續時間值。應該與待檢驗的值的大小相同。

註釋如果忽略待求和的值,預設值將為待檢驗的值。

儘管待檢驗的值可以包含任何值,但通常包含的值全都應該屬於同一值型別。

如果忽略待求和的值,待檢驗的值通常僅含有數字或持續時間值。

示例假設**如下:

=sumif(a1:a5, 「<5」) 得出 10,因為 1、2、3 和 4(條件的值小於 5,包含在待檢驗的值的範圍 a1:a5 內)的和是 10。

=sumif(a1:a5, 「<5」, b1:b5) 得出 100,因為 10、20、30 和 40(a 列中小於 5 的值在 b 列(待求和的值 是 b1:

b5)中所對應的值)的總和是 100。

=sumif(d1:e3, 「=c」, a3:b5) 得出 84,因為與待檢驗的值中等於「c」的單元格(單元格 e1、d2 和 e3)對應的待求和的值中的單元格(單元格 b3、a4 和 b5)包含 30、4 和 50,總和為 84。

=sumif(a1:d5, 1) 或 =sumif(a1:d5, sum(1)) 各得出 2,即範圍內所有出現的 1 的總和。

countif 函式得出某個集合內滿足給定條件的單元格的個數。

countif(待檢驗陣列, 條件)

待檢驗陣列: 集合,包含要測試的值。 待檢驗陣列可以包含任何值。

條件: 比較或檢驗值,並返回布林值 true 或 false 的表示式。 條件可包括比較運算子、常數、與符號並置運算子、引用表示式和萬用字元。

您可以使用萬用字元來匹配表示式中的任何單個字元或多個字元。您可以使用的萬用字元包括 ?(問號)、*(星號)以及 ~(波浪號)。

若要查詢有關萬用字元的更多資訊,請開啟應用程式中的「幫助」選單,然後在搜尋欄輸入「萬用字元」。

註釋每個待檢驗陣列值都要與條件進行比較。如果某值滿足條件測試,則它將包括在計數中。

示例以下**中的資訊沒什麼意義,但能說明包括在結果中的 countif 引數的引數型別。

假設**如下:

=countif(a1:d1, 「>0」) 得出 4,因為此集合內所有單元格中的值都大於 0。

=countif(a3:d3, 「>=100」) 得出 3,因為比較時三個數字全都大於或等於 100,且文字值被忽略。

=countif(a1:d5, 「=ipsum」) 得出 1,因為文字字串「ipsum」在該範圍引用的集合內出現一次。

=countif(a1:d5, 「=*t」) 得出 2,因為以字母「t」結尾的字串在該範圍引用的集合內出現兩次。

示例——調查結果

本示例彙總了統計函式中使用的舉例說明。它基於假設的調查。這項調查很短(只有 5 個問題)且接受調查者非常有限 (10)。

應該以等級 1 到 5 回答每個問題(可能範圍從「從不」到「總是」),也可以不回答問題。每個調查都先編號再郵寄。下表顯示了結果。

回答超出範圍(錯誤)或未回答的問題在**中使用空白單元格表示。

為了舉例說明部分函式,假定字母字首中包括調查控制編號,且數值範圍是 a–e,而非 1–5。那麼**將如下:

使用此**中的資料和部分可用統計函式,可以收集有關調查結果的資訊。請記住,本示例故意設為小型,以便可讓結果比較明顯。但是,如果具有 50、100 或更多接受調查者,且可能具有很多問題,則結果將不明顯。

函式和引數

結果描述

=correl(b2:b11, c2:c11)

使用線性迴歸分析確定問題 1 和問題 2 之間的相關性。相關性可衡量兩個變數(此示例中是指調查問題的答案)一起變化的程度。這具體取決於問題:

如果被調查者對問題 1 的回答值比問題 1 的平均值高(或低),則被調查者對問題 2 的回答值是否也比問題 2 的平均值高(或低)?在此示例中,回答不明顯相關 (-0.1732)

=count(a2:a11) 或 =counta(a2:a11)

確定返回的調查總數 (10)。請注意,如果調查控制識別符號不是數值,則需要使用 counta,而非 count。

=count(b2:b11) 或 =counta(b2:b11)

確定第一個問題 (9) 的答案總數。通過跨行擴充套件此公式,可以確定每個問題的答案總數。由於所有資料都是數值,因此 counta 得出的結果相同。

但是,如果調查使用 a-e,而非 1-5,將需要使用 counta 來記錄結果。

=countblank(b2:b11)

確定空單元格(表示無效回答或無回答)的數量。如果跨行擴充套件此公式,則將發現問題 3(d 列)具有 3 個無效或未回答的答案。這可能會讓您在調查中檢視此問題,瞭解措辭是否有爭議或較差,因為其他問題的錯誤或未回答答案都沒有超過 1 個。

=countif(b2:b11, 「=5」)

確定為特定問題(此示例中是問題 1)給出等級 5 的被調查者人數。如果跨行擴充套件此公式,將瞭解到僅問題 1 和 4 是任何被調查者均給出了問題答案 5。如果調查使用 a-e 範圍,將使用 =countif(b2:

b11, 「=e」)。

=covar(b2:b11, c2:c11)

確定問題 1 和問題 2 的協方差。協方差可衡量兩個變數(此示例中是指調查問題的答案)一起變化的程度。這具體取決於問題:

如果被調查者對問題 1 的回答值比問題 1 的平均值高(或低),則被調查者對問題 2 的回答值是否也比問題 2 的平均值高(或低)?

注:covar 不會使用數值範圍 a–e 處理**,因為它需要數值引數。

=stdev(b2:b11) 或 =stdevp(b2:b11)

確定問題 1 回答的標準偏差(離差的一種度量)。如果跨行擴充套件此公式,將發現問題 3 的回答具有最高標準偏差。如果結果表示被調查者總體的回答,而不是某個人的回答,則使用 stdevp,而不是 stdev。

請注意,stdev 是 var 的平方根。

=var(b2:b11) 或 =varp(b2:b11)

確定問題 1 回答的方差(離差的一種度量)。如果跨行擴充套件此公式,將發現問題 5 的回答具有最低方差。如果結果表示被調查者總體的回答,而不是某個人的回答,則使用 varp,而不是 var。

請注意,var 是 stdev 的平方。

excel 2019中如何快速篩選出指定姓名的記錄

給你個建議,辦法較笨 首先,將 複製一份,以備不測 1 將姓名列複製,插入到表的第1列 2 將表的範圍全部選中 不要選擇帶欄位名的表頭 3 執行 a z 的升序排序快捷鍵,就將各種不同的姓名與對應成績按姓集中了 資料 篩選 自動篩選 自定義 始於 周。自動篩選 周 不就行了 單擊 資料 篩選 自動篩...

EXCEL如何篩選資料,excel如何篩選出符合條件的資料?

excel如何篩選數字?1自動篩選 首先拖動滑鼠選中整個 再點選上面選單欄中的資料,點選 篩選 第一行抬頭處每個單元格會有一個下拉箭頭。2點選任意一個抬頭處的下拉按鈕,可以看到最上面有三個排序功能,升序 降序和按顏色排序,用這個功能可以對資料進行排序操作。3點選下方的 全選 時會把所有目標選中,也可...

excel2019中有AB兩列資料,一列大約1萬個,如何把B列中和A列重複的資料刪除

直接刪除是需要用vba的。你的情況用不著 c1輸入 if countif a a,b1 b1,下拉公式 c列產生的就是ab二列都有的資料。剩下的我想你應該知道如何操作了 你是要bai 分別刪除a列和b列中 du的重複資料zhi還是要一起刪除ab兩列dao中的重複資料專?只刪除b列中重屬復的資料,一次...